Ethan Kytle

Ethan J. Kytle is professor of history at California State University, Fresno. A specialist in the history of slavery, abolition, the Civil War, and the U.S. South, he is author of two books: Romantic Reformers and the Antislavery Struggle in the Civil War Era (Cambridge University Press, 2014) and, with co-author Blain Roberts, Denmark Vesey’s Garden: Slavery and Memory in the Cradle of the Confederacy (New Press, 2018). He has also written for the Journal of Southern History, American Nineteenth Century History, the New York Times, and the Atlantic.
